// eefw-security-173-start if (!function_exists('eefw_home_hosts')) { function eefw_home_hosts() { $host = wp_parse_url(home_url(), PHP_URL_HOST); $hosts = array(); if ($host) { $hosts[] = strtolower($host); if (stripos($host, 'www.') === 0) { $hosts[] = strtolower(substr($host, 4)); } else { $hosts[] = 'www.' . strtolower($host); } } return array_values(array_unique($hosts)); } function eefw_allowed_hosts() { $common = array( 's.w.org','stats.wp.com','www.googletagmanager.com','tagmanager.google.com', 'www.google-analytics.com','ssl.google-analytics.com','region1.google-analytics.com', 'analytics.google.com','www.google.com','www.gstatic.com','ssl.gstatic.com', 'www.recaptcha.net','recaptcha.net','challenges.cloudflare.com','js.stripe.com', 'www.paypal.com','sandbox.paypal.com','www.sandbox.paypal.com', 'maps.googleapis.com','maps.gstatic.com','www.youtube.com','youtube.com', 'www.youtube-nocookie.com','youtube-nocookie.com','s.ytimg.com','i.ytimg.com', 'player.vimeo.com','f.vimeocdn.com','i.vimeocdn.com', 'fonts.googleapis.com','fonts.gstatic.com','cdn.jsdelivr.net' ); return array_values(array_unique(array_merge(eefw_home_hosts(), $common))); } function eefw_normalize_url($url) { if (!is_string($url) || $url === '') return $url; if (strpos($url, '//') === 0) return (is_ssl() ? 'https:' : 'http:') . $url; return $url; } function eefw_is_relative_url($url) { return is_string($url) && $url !== '' && strpos($url, '/') === 0 && strpos($url, '//') !== 0; } function eefw_host_allowed($host) { if (!$host) return true; return in_array(strtolower($host), eefw_allowed_hosts(), true); } function eefw_url_allowed($url) { if (!is_string($url) || $url === '') return true; if (eefw_is_relative_url($url)) return true; $url = eefw_normalize_url($url); $host = wp_parse_url($url, PHP_URL_HOST); if (!$host) return true; return eefw_host_allowed($host); } add_filter('script_loader_src', function($src) { if (!eefw_url_allowed($src)) return false; return $src; }, 9999); add_action('wp_enqueue_scripts', function() { global $wp_scripts; if (!isset($wp_scripts->registered) || !is_array($wp_scripts->registered)) return; foreach ($wp_scripts->registered as $handle => $obj) { if (!empty($obj->src) && !eefw_url_allowed($obj->src)) { wp_dequeue_script($handle); wp_deregister_script($handle); } } }, 9999); add_action('template_redirect', function() { if (is_admin() || (defined('REST_REQUEST') && REST_REQUEST) || (defined('DOING_AJAX') && DOING_AJAX)) return; ob_start(function($html) { if (!is_string($html) || $html === '') return $html; $html = preg_replace_callback( '#]*)\\bsrc=([\'\"])(.*?)\\2([^>]*)>\\s*<\/script>#is', function($m) { $src = html_entity_decode($m[3], ENT_QUOTES | ENT_HTML5, 'UTF-8'); if (!eefw_url_allowed($src)) return ''; return $m[0]; }, $html ); $bad_needles = array_map('base64_decode', explode(',', 'Y2hlY2suZmlyc3Qtbm9kZS5yb2Nrcw==,dGVzdGlvLmVjYXJ0ZGV2LmNvbQ==,Y2FwdGNoYV9zZWVu,Y3RwX3Bhc3Nf,aW5zZXJ0QWRqYWNlbnRIVE1MKA==,d2luZG93LmFkZEV2ZW50TGlzdGVuZXIo,ZmV0Y2go,bmV3IEZ1bmN0aW9uKA==,ZXZhbCg=,YXRvYig=' )); $html = preg_replace_callback( '#]*>.*?<\/script>#is', function($m) use ($bad_needles) { foreach ($bad_needles as $needle) { if (stripos($m[0], $needle) !== false) return ''; } return $m[0]; }, $html ); return $html; }); }, 1); add_action('send_headers', function() { if (headers_sent()) return; $hosts = eefw_allowed_hosts(); $h2 = array('\'self\''); foreach ($hosts as $hh) $h2[] = 'https://' . $hh; $sc = implode(' ', array_unique(array_merge($h2, array('\'unsafe-inline\'', '\'unsafe-eval\'')))); $st = implode(' ', array_unique(array_merge(array('\'self\'', '\'unsafe-inline\''), array('https://fonts.googleapis.com')))); $ft = implode(' ', array_unique(array_merge(array('\'self\'', 'data:'), array('https://fonts.gstatic.com')))); $ig = implode(' ', array_unique(array_merge(array('\'self\'', 'data:', 'blob:'), $h2))); $fr = implode(' ', array_unique(array_merge(array('\'self\''), array( 'https://www.youtube.com','https://www.youtube-nocookie.com', 'https://player.vimeo.com','https://www.google.com', 'https://challenges.cloudflare.com','https://js.stripe.com', 'https://www.paypal.com','https://sandbox.paypal.com' )))); $cn = implode(' ', array_unique(array_merge(array('\'self\''), array( 'https://www.google-analytics.com','https://region1.google-analytics.com', 'https://analytics.google.com','https://maps.googleapis.com', 'https://maps.gstatic.com','https://challenges.cloudflare.com', 'https://js.stripe.com','https://www.paypal.com','https://sandbox.paypal.com' )))); $p = array( "default-src 'self'", 'script-src ' . $sc, 'style-src ' . $st, 'font-src ' . $ft, 'img-src ' . $ig, 'frame-src ' . $fr, 'connect-src ' . $cn, "object-src 'none'", "base-uri 'self'", "form-action 'self' https://www.paypal.com https://sandbox.paypal.com" ); header('Content-Security-Policy: ' . implode('; ', $p)); }, 999); } // eefw-security-173-end Spinanga Gaming Casino Crafted for Portable Gamers in AUS – Dallas Area Municipal Authority

Spinanga Gaming Casino Crafted for Portable Gamers in AUS

Spinanga Casino, 400% Bonus bis € 80 mit unserem Code

At Our Casino, we’ve an remarkable platform customized specifically for portable gamers in Australia spinanga-kazino.com. Our layout prioritizes a smooth UX, ensuring that playing on the go feels effortless. With a wide array of options and enticing promotions, we serve a broad group looking for both thrill and comfort. Let’s explore how our features stand out in the competitive internet gaming market and what makes us a top option for on-the-go aficionados.

Summary of Our Casino

When we explore the realm of online gambling, Our Casino stands out as an attractive alternative for portable players in AUS. This platform’s diverse Our Casino characteristics position it as a player in the lively Aussie arena. With a vast selection of games, including slots, table games, and live dealer features, we encounter something to match every taste. Plus, the bountiful bonuses and deals give exciting chances for gamers to elevate their adventure. The intuitive interface simplifies browsing, allowing us to quickly reach our preferred titles without difficulty. Additionally, Our Casino’s focus to protection ensures our information stays safe and safe. In summary, Our Casino provides a appealing mix of fun and protection, making it a top option for portable gambling enthusiasts.

Mobile Adaptation and User Interaction

Although we often focus on game variety, the mobile advancement and user experience at Spinanga Casino are just as remarkable. The mobile interface is sleek, user-friendly, and crafted for players on the go. We’ve noticed that every feature is optimized for touch functionality, making navigation seamless and simple. You won’t have difficulty to find your favorite games or promotions, which truly enhances our user experience. Additionally, the responsive design guarantees quick load times, so we don’t have to wait to plunge ourselves in the action. Spinanga Casino recognizes our desire for uninterrupted gameplay wherever we are, providing a platform that meets our expectations. Fundamentally, the commitment to mobile enhancement not only broadens our freedom but also advances our gaming adventure.

Game Selection for On-the-Go Players

When we choose games for our mobile experience at Spinanga Casino, variety is key. With a broad range of options, from slots to table games, we can find something that matches our mood. Plus, the mobile enhancement features guarantee that we enjoy uninterrupted gameplay, wherever we are.

Diverse Game Offerings

As we dive into the world of mobile gaming at Spinanga Casino, we reveal a vibrant fabric of game offerings that cater to every type of player. The game variety here is impressive, effortlessly blending classic favorites with new titles. Whether we crave fast-paced slots, strategic table games, or immersive live dealer experiences, Spinanga has us covered. Each game reflects diverse player preferences, ensuring everyone finds something they love. Plus, the easy navigation makes discovering new games a snap, enhancing our overall enjoyment. This blend of variety and accessibility allows us to enjoy our gaming journey, no matter where we are. So, let’s investigate and immerse in the endless possibilities that await us at Spinanga Casino!

Mobile Optimization Features

At Spinanga Casino, we’re thrilled by the mobile enhancement features that guarantee our gaming experience is flawless, whether we’re at home or on the move. Our user interface has been meticulously designed to provide effortless navigation—allowing us to jump right into our preferred games without any hassle. With performance improvements, we’re experiencing quicker load times and smooth gameplay, perfect for those impromptu gaming sessions between commitments. We’ve noticed that the game selection is optimized for mobile, ensuring we have access to a broad range of slots, table games, and live dealer options, all in our pockets. This combination of user-friendly design and superior performance truly captures freedom, keeping us engaged and entertained anytime, anywhere.

Promotions and Bonuses for Australian Players

Australian players can take advantage of a range of exciting promotions and bonuses at Spinanga Casino, enhancing our gaming experience greatly. These promotional offers not only enhance our bankroll but also keep the thrill ongoing.

Here are some common bonus types we can investigate:

  • Welcome Bonus
  • No Deposit Bonuses
  • Loyalty Rewards

With these appealing bonuses and promotions, Spinanga Casino truly fulfills our desire for freedom and enjoyment in online gambling. Let’s make the most of these chances!

Payment Options and Security Features

With the thrill of promotions new in our minds, it’s time to explore the payment options and security features that Spinanga Casino offers to boost our gaming experience. They offer a range of transaction options customized to our preferences, including credit cards, e-wallets, and even cryptocurrencies. This range not only adds convenience but also allows us the freedom to choose what best matches our lifestyle.

Now, we can’t neglect payment security. Spinanga uses advanced encryption technology, securing our sensitive information is kept safeguarded throughout all transactions. Additionally, their commitment to responsible gaming reflects their dedication to our wellbeing. By prioritizing both accessibility and security, Spinanga Casino provides a fluid experience, enabling us to enjoy our gaming adventures without unnecessary worries.

Customer Support and Assistance

Spinanga Casino Review: Scam or safe? - Scamosafe.com

How do we assure that our gaming experience remains uninterrupted at Spinanga Casino? By providing high-quality customer support, we guarantee that all your questions and concerns are quickly addressed. Whether you’re encountering a minor hiccup or need guidance, we’ve got your back.

Our support includes:

  • Live chat
  • Email support
  • Comprehensive help center

With these channels, we allow you to enjoy the freedom of gaming without interruption. Our committed support team is always here, ready to assist you in enhancing your Spinanga Casino experience.